European Export of Men's or Boys' Bib and Brace Overalls of Textile Fabrics Not Knitted or Crocheted by Country

In 2023, the European export market for men's or boys' bib and brace overalls saw Italy leading significantly with 5.7932 million items exported. The Netherlands, Belgium, and Germany followed with moderate figures, while countries like Malta experienced substantial growth (187.38%). Croatia showed a notable increase (102.06%), despite its lower overall volume. Conversely, Spain saw a drastic drop (-100%). Over the past five years, some countries like Italy and Lithuania have shown steady growth, whereas others like Austria have faced decline. The compounded annual growth rate suggests diverse performance across countries.

Top countries in Export of Men's or Boys' Bib and Brace Overalls of Textile Fabrics Not Knitted or Crocheted by Country

# 10 Countries Units (Items) Last Year YoY 5-years CAGR
1 1 Italy 5,793,200 2023 +1.25% +13.7% View data
2 2 Netherlands 372,520 2023 +2.81% +30.3% View data
3 3 Belgium 264,160 2021 +100.33% -1.03% View data
4 4 Germany 179,090 2023 +0.21% -2.42% View data
5 5 Bulgaria 142,640 2023 -0.88% -3.59% View data
6 6 United Kingdom 82,760 2023 -1.72% +3.87% View data
7 7 Poland 73,140 2023 +2.22% +3.09% View data
8 8 Hungary 43,850 2023 +4.63% +5.29% View data
9 9 France 42,110 2023 +32.73% +14.92% View data
10 10 Denmark 29,910 2021 +24.86% +3.18% View data
